Phone number ☎️ 004917717816951 👆 is reported as a number linked to text alerts about parcels, often claiming to be from Wish. Some users say they receive frequent or unwanted messages, sometimes in Polish, that can be difficult to delete or ignore. There are complaints about being charged for these texts unexpectedly. Several people suspect the messages to be scams or attempts to trick users into clicking malicious links, warning that the content might lead to hacking or spam. Others believe the texts are legitimate parcel updates connected to online orders. Overall, the number causes mixed reactions - some consider it nuisance or suspicious, while others see it as genuine notifications related to online shopping deliveries.
